UC Green Pruning Club Continues

2009 is the 6th year for UC Green organized citizen volunteer tree pruners to maintain the health, safety and beauty of our street trees in West Philadelphia.
All are welcome and no experience is necessary. Bring pruning tools, if you have them. Tools and instruction will be available for all. Certified community arborists will be your instructors. Please bring a friend if you know someone who would be interested.
